After reading some reviews and talking to some of my coworkers, I made a short note in my phone for places to visit while we were there. Our condo rental came with a golf cart, but if your accommodations don’t include one, I would recommend renting one. There are no cars on the island and very few cabs – plus let’s be honest – driving around a golf cart everywhere is pretty fun! Here are some of the things we did that I’d recommend:
Dinner at Bluewater Grill – a view of the boats and yachts and delish seafood can’t be beat!
A visit or peek inside El Galleon for karaoke – because it’s hilarious.
Lunch and a Buffalo Milk at Descanso Beach Club – according to reader comments they have the best Buffalo Milk cocktail on the island!
Sushi and wine/beer tastings at CC Gallagher – my favorite meal during our visit (and we would stop by periodically for their delicious coffee!).
Zip Line Eco Tour – I’ve zip-lined in Mexico and Christian has zip-lined in Belizé, so he wasn’t up for it – but I think the next time we visit I will force him.
An ice cream cone from Big Olaf’s – the smell is intoxicating!
Renting a pedal boat.
And that’s about it! The island and town are very small, so the best part of all is relaxing and slowing down to that island pace. Have you visited Catalina? If you have any spots you think I missed I’d love to hear!

I love this watermelon salad recipe that she’s allowed me to share with you guys. So delicious and summer fresh – even better when accompanied with a glass of Seven Daughters Wine (which is not on the program… so don’t tell!).
Ingredients:
4 cups chopped watermelon
1 cup spinach
6 basil leaves, chopped
2 TB pumpkin seeds
1 lime, juiced
Directions:
Mix everything together other than the lime juice. Add the lime juice last. Optional: add a source of protein (chicken, fish).
